Poner en este source code los botones abajo
Publicado por Israel (3 intervenciones) el 30/07/2012 10:49:50
Alguien me podría indicar como poner los botones de mi source code abajo???
Un saludo.
import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
// Ventana (clase principal)
public class Ventana {
// main
public static void main(String[] args) {
System.out.println("Bienvenido a Insert From BlackBerry"); // Mensaje de bienvenida
JFrame vent = new JFrame(); // Una ventana
JButton btnCerrar = new JButton("Cerrar"); // Un botón
JButton btnEnviar = new JButton("Enviar"); // Un botón
Container cnt = vent.getContentPane(); // Contenedor de la ventana
// Propiedades del botón
btnCerrar.addActionListener(new OyenteBoton());
//Propiedades del botón
btnEnviar.addActionListener(new OyenteBoton());
// Añadir botón a la ventana:
cnt.add(btnCerrar);
// Añadir botón a la ventana:
cnt.add(btnEnviar);
// Propiedades de la ventana
vent.setLocation(100, 100);
vent.setSize(400, 300);
vent.setTitle("InsertFromBB");
// Un Layout es la forma en que los controles se colocan
// en la ventana a medida que se añaden. FlowLayout
// coloca cada control a continuación del anterior.
vent.setLayout(new FlowLayout());
// Añadir el oyente a la ventana y mostrarla:
vent.addWindowListener(new OyenteVentana());
vent.setVisible(true);
}
}
// Oyente de la ventana
class OyenteVentana extends WindowAdapter {
// Oyente del evento de cierre de ventana
public void windowClosing(WindowEvent e) {
System.exit(0); // Salir del programa
}
}
// Oyente del botón
class OyenteBoton implements ActionListener {
// Oyente del evento de clic en el botón
public void actionPerformed(ActionEvent e) {
// Si el texto del control es "Cerrar",
// el programa termina.
if (e.getActionCommand() == "Cerrar")
System.exit(0);
}
}
Un saludo.
import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
// Ventana (clase principal)
public class Ventana {
// main
public static void main(String[] args) {
System.out.println("Bienvenido a Insert From BlackBerry"); // Mensaje de bienvenida
JFrame vent = new JFrame(); // Una ventana
JButton btnCerrar = new JButton("Cerrar"); // Un botón
JButton btnEnviar = new JButton("Enviar"); // Un botón
Container cnt = vent.getContentPane(); // Contenedor de la ventana
// Propiedades del botón
btnCerrar.addActionListener(new OyenteBoton());
//Propiedades del botón
btnEnviar.addActionListener(new OyenteBoton());
// Añadir botón a la ventana:
cnt.add(btnCerrar);
// Añadir botón a la ventana:
cnt.add(btnEnviar);
// Propiedades de la ventana
vent.setLocation(100, 100);
vent.setSize(400, 300);
vent.setTitle("InsertFromBB");
// Un Layout es la forma en que los controles se colocan
// en la ventana a medida que se añaden. FlowLayout
// coloca cada control a continuación del anterior.
vent.setLayout(new FlowLayout());
// Añadir el oyente a la ventana y mostrarla:
vent.addWindowListener(new OyenteVentana());
vent.setVisible(true);
}
}
// Oyente de la ventana
class OyenteVentana extends WindowAdapter {
// Oyente del evento de cierre de ventana
public void windowClosing(WindowEvent e) {
System.exit(0); // Salir del programa
}
}
// Oyente del botón
class OyenteBoton implements ActionListener {
// Oyente del evento de clic en el botón
public void actionPerformed(ActionEvent e) {
// Si el texto del control es "Cerrar",
// el programa termina.
if (e.getActionCommand() == "Cerrar")
System.exit(0);
}
}
Valora esta pregunta


0